Gauze Roll, Cotton Gauze, Cotton Roll manufacturer / supplier in China, offering Agricultural Chemicals Insecticide Amitraz 98%Tc 12.5% Ec 20% Ec, Highly Effective Agrochemical Insecticide Pesticide & Acaricide Amitraz 20% Ec for Wholesale, Agricultural Insecticides Insecticida Amitraz Veterinary Use for Dogs Cats and so on.
Suppliers with verified business licenses